Default Steering wheel replacement

Mine is an '87 S4 with the rather ugly steering wheel (no air bag). For such a beautiful car, they didn't extend the beauty to the steering wheel. Anybody want to comment on a nice looking wheel, preferably from a used car that would spruce up an otherwise nice interior?

I found a Momo "runner" three spoke. Also known as a Momo "Club 3". They pop up every now and then on ebay. Very similar to a Porsche 930 wheel but less expensive.

The wheel MainePorsche showed is a "Club 4"

Barney,

We just fitted a "930" sport wheel to our '88s4, and like it a lot. Porsche offers a version of this wheel with the 928 hub, as mentioned Roger has them. Not cheap, though. We got ours used from 928 Int'l.

The Momo's are really nice, also. Be sure to get the correct hub or adapter for the 928.
